Output 84c3b11ea4c8a161921ff48fb99f61e6a7fa97e4017c10197372e720fcba426a:0

value
94550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f85816decaaec0d6e97591f5e7fbab21b52c91 OP_EQUAL
address
3CY5ARubaquGa9ZWooETYZiNmdv4X2mdef
transaction
84c3b11ea4c8a161921ff48fb99f61e6a7fa97e4017c10197372e720fcba426a
spent
true